Understand the Difference Between NDA, CDS, and AFCAT Before beginning your preparation, it is crucial to understand which entrance exam aligns best with your educational background and career aspirations: NDA (National Defence Academy) Target Group: Students who have completed Class 12 or equivalent (10+2) Age Limit: 16.5 to 19.5 years Conducted By: Union Public Service Commission (UPSC) Purpose: Selection for Indian Army, Navy, and Air Force through the prestigious NDA training academy CDS (Combined Defence Services) Target Group: Graduates from any recognized university Age Limit: Typically 19 to 25 years (varies by academy – IMA, OTA, INA, AFA) Conducted By: Union Public Service Commission (UPSC) Purpose: Entry into Indian Military Academy (IMA), Officer Training Academy (OTA), Indian Naval Academy (INA), and Air Force Academy (AFA) AFCAT (Air Force Common Admission Test) Target Group: Graduates with specified qualifications Age Limit: As specified per branch and entry type Conducted By: Indian Air Force Purpose: Officer entry into the Indian Air Force in various branches including flying and ground duties Step-by-Step Guide to Start Your NDA/CDS/AFCAT Preparation from Scratch 1. What is the SSB Interview and Why Proper Coaching Matters The Services Selection Board (SSB) interview is much more than a written test or an interview; it is a multi-day assessment process aimed at evaluating candidates on multiple parameters essential for a career as an officer in the Indian Armed Forces. The key areas assessed include: Officer Like Qualities (OLQs): Leadership, teamwork, self-confidence, and initiative. Psychology Tests: Including Thematic Apperception Test (TAT), Word Association Test (WAT), Situation Reaction Test (SRT), all designed to assess personality traits and mental resilience. Group Testing Officer Tasks (GTO): Group discussions, outdoor tasks, group planning exercises to evaluate teamwork, leadership, and interpersonal skills. Personal Interview: To judge communication skills, decision-making, and overall personality. Many candidates with strong academic records fail SSB because they lack an understanding of the process and expectations. Comprehensive coaching from a reputed institute equips aspirants with knowledge of the testing patterns, enhances their officer-like qualities, and builds confidence. Understand the CDS Exam Pattern A clear understanding of the CDS exam pattern is crucial to optimize your preparation strategy. The exam pattern varies slightly depending on the academy you are targeting: For IMA (Indian Military Academy), INA (Indian Naval Academy), and AFA (Air Force Academy): The written exam consists of three subjects – English, General Knowledge, and Mathematics. For OTA (Officers Training Academy): The written exam includes only English and General Knowledge. Each subject demands a customized preparation approach. Early clarity about the pattern helps you allocate time and resources effectively from day one. This article from LWS (LWS Pune) will guide you through comprehensive tips to improve OLQs and excel in your defence career journey. What Are OLQs (Officer Like Qualities)? OLQs refer to a set of personality traits and characteristics that the SSB assesses to evaluate whether a candidate has the potential to become an effective officer in the Indian Armed Forces. These qualities reflect a candidate’s leadership ability, mental alertness, social skills, emotional resilience, and physical fitness to perform under challenging conditions. The SSB divides OLQs into four broad categories: Planning & Organizing: The ability to set goals, plan strategies, and manage resources efficiently. Social Adjustment: Adaptability to situations, social awareness, and maintaining good interpersonal relationships. Social Effectiveness: The skill to influence, motivate, and cooperate effectively with others. Dynamic Traits: Energy, enthusiasm, determination, leadership, and initiative-taking capabilities. Practice Psychological Tests The SSB psychological tests – TAT (Thematic Apperception Test), WAT (Word Association Test), and SRT (Situation Reaction Test) – assess your innate personality traits. To excel: Regularly practice these tests with honesty and natural responses. Avoid memorizing answers; authenticity is crucial. Reflect on your real thoughts and feelings during practice. Why is a Positive Attitude Important in SSB? The SSB process is specifically designed to evaluate your Officer Like Qualities, including leadership, adaptability, and resilience. Among these, a positive attitude plays a pivotal role by directly influencing: Your overall performance in psychological tests (TAT, WAT, SRT) Behavior and teamwork during Group Testing Officer (GTO) tasks Your confidence and composure in the personal interview Your ability to remain calm and focused under pressure A candidate with a positive mindset is perceived as someone capable of leading effectively, adapting to evolving challenges, and inspiring peers – all vital traits for an officer candidate. What Does a ā€œPositive Attitudeā€ Mean in SSB? Having a positive attitude in SSB is not about displaying unrealistic cheerfulness or ignoring difficulties. Instead, it involves: Facing challenges confidently and with a balanced approach Responding to situations logically rather than emotionally Focusing on finding solutions rather than dwelling on problems Maintaining composure and self-control even in difficult or unexpected scenarios This attitude demonstrates maturity, mental strength, and the capacity for rational decision-making – traits that the SSB wants to identify and nurture. Positive Attitude in Different Stages of the SSB Process Psychological Tests Your stories, word associations, and reactions should reflect optimism, responsibility, and practical solutions rather than negativity or passivity. GTO Tasks During GTO group tasks, encouraging your peers, cooperating effectively, and remaining calm—even in adverse situations—highlight a positive personality. Personal Interview Honesty, confidence, and composure are the hallmarks of a positive attitude here. Your body language and answers must reflect sincerity and positivity.
